HomeMy WebLinkAbout102521ca02 JEFFERSON COUNTY BOARD OF COUNTY COMMISSIONERS AGENDA REQUEST TO: Board of County Commissioners Mark McCauley, Interim County Administrator FROM: Matthew Court—Facilities Foreman DATE: QOkK O y 00a SUBJECT: Sheriff Office Pole Barn Addition STATEMENT OF ISSUE: The Sheriff has decided to vacate the current workout room in the Sheriffs Administration Building. To enable this, County Facilities has agreed to enlarge the Sheriff's pole building. The expanded pole building will provide more space for deputies to work out and to conduct indoor training. The County IT department will take over the vacated workout room in the Administration building creating a secure location for the new County Main Network Server. ANALYSIS: We are currently running multiple server locations throughout the County and all are due for major upgrades. By centrally locating the Main Server at a new secure location the County can save the additional cost of replacing redundant equipment at multiple locations. This also reinforces the physical security of our County Main Network Server by having it behind two locking doors in a high security location. This is a win-win for the Sheriff and the County IT department. FISCAL IMPACT: The building addition will cost $39,824. The Construction and Renovation Fund has budget adequate to over the cost of the building addition. RECOMMENDATION: That the Board of County Commissioners approve the attached contract.
